Strengthening Customer Security with Voice ID

In today's digital landscape, safeguarding customer information is paramount. Voice recognition technology offers a novel and robust method for verifying user access. By leveraging the unique characteristics of an individual's voice, organizations can establish a multi-factor security protocol that effectively prevents the risk of unauthorized access.

  • Biometric voice authentication analyze key traits of a user's voice, such as pitch, tone, and cadence, to generate a distinct identifier. This pattern-based representation can then be compared against previously stored voice profiles.
  • Implementing voice ID can simplify customer access processes, providing a seamless experience. Users can simply utter a designated phrase or command to validate their identity.
  • Moreover, voice ID delivers enhanced security compared to traditional methods like passwords, which are susceptible to theft. Voice data is inherently challenging to forge or imitate, making it a robust deterrent against malicious activities.

As technology advances, voice ID is poised to play an increasingly integral role in securing customer data and preserving confidentiality. By embracing this innovative solution, companies can fortify their security posture and cultivate trust with their customers.

Voice Biometrics Are Changing Banking Forever

Banks are embracing a new era of security and convenience with the integration of voice biometrics. This cutting-edge technology utilizes an individual's unique voice print to verify their identity, eliminating the need for traditional passwords or security tokens. The rise of voice biometrics holds immense potential the banking experience, making it more secure and streamlined.

Voice biometric systems analyze the nuances of a person's voice, such as frequency, cadence, and articulation, to build a unique voice profile. When a customer engages their bank, the system matches their voice against their voice print. This real-time verification process ensures that only authorized individuals are granted access to their accounts and sensitive banking details.

  • {Improved Security: Voice biometrics offer a higher level of security compared to traditional methods, as it is difficult to forge or replicate a unique voice print.
  • Enhanced Customer Experience: Customers can experience faster and more seamless interactions with their banks, eliminating the frustration of entering passwords or remembering security tokens.
  • Reduced Fraud: By effectively identifying legitimate customers, voice biometrics help prevent fraudulent transactions
